تفاصيل الدورة

• Child Development and Resilience: Understanding the key developmental stages of children and young people, and how building resilience can help them navigate these stages successfully.

• The Science of Resilience: An exploration of the biological and psychological factors that contribute to resilience in children and young people, including the role of genetics, environment, and stress.

• Building Resilience through Relationships: An examination of how positive relationships with parents, caregivers, and other supportive adults can foster resilience in children and young people.

• Resilience-building Interventions: An overview of evidence-based interventions and strategies for building resilience in children and young people, including cognitive-behavioral therapy, mindfulness, and social-emotional learning.

• Promoting Resilience in Schools: A consideration of how schools can create supportive environments that promote resilience, including strategies for addressing bullying, promoting positive behavior, and supporting students' social-emotional development.

• Trauma and Resilience: An examination of the impact of trauma on children and young people, and how building resilience can help them cope with and recover from traumatic experiences.

• Cultural Considerations in Resilience-building: An exploration of how cultural factors can influence the development of resilience in children and young people, and strategies for building resilience in diverse populations.

• Measuring Resilience: An overview of tools and techniques for assessing resilience in children and young people, including self-report measures and observational assessments.

• Ethical Considerations in Resilience-building: A discussion of ethical issues related to building resilience in children and young people, including issues of consent, confidentiality, and cultural sensitivity.
